AKG HP12U 12-Channel Headphone Amplifier with USB
Key Features
  • 6 x Stereo Output Channels
  • 2 x Headphone Outputs per Channel
  • 2 x Stereo Input Channels
  • Selectable Source Input
The HP12U 12-Channel Headphone Amplifier with USB from AKG features two stereo input and six stereo output channels, each with two 1/4" outputs. It can be used to easily monitor your analog or digital equipment – without rewiring your headphones – by switching between inputs A and B. Simply connect multiple units if you need more channels. In addition, the HP12U can also be used as an external sound card by connecting input A to your computer via USB. Housed in a sturdy chassis, the HP12U is an ideal headphone amplifier for any recording session.

Will this unit drive a 250 ohm headphone with enough power to where I dont feel like I need a higher power amp?
Asked by: Clinton
This is a professional, studio- quality headphone amplifier that is compatible with low and high impedance headphones, and will have the power to handle 250 Ohm headphones.

Will the input B on the back accepts quarter inch input? I see a XLR and a quarter inch jack there.
Asked by: Mo N.
Channel B has XLR connectors. The 1/4 inch connectors are for channel A and the link outputs.
